Thoughts on Theses: Rana Barghout
Rana Barghout is a neuroscience major writing a thesis on the lateral line
system and startle responses in zebrafish. Her advisor is Professor of Biology
Josef Trapani.
Q: What’s your thesis about?
A: For survival, it’s important to be able to respond to sudden stimuli, along
with avoiding